openVPN中explicit-exit-notify如何使用给出例子
explicit-exit-notify是OpenVPN的一个配置参数,它指定当OpenVPN客户端与服务器之间的连接断开时,客户端是否应该发送一个显式的退出通知给服务器。这个参数可以设置为yes或no,默认值是no。
如果设置为yes,当OpenVPN客户端与服务器之间的连接断开时,客户端会发送一个显式的SIGTERM信号给OpenVPN进程,以便服务器可以知道客户端已经退出。这可以帮助服务器及时地清理连接和资源。
下面是一个使用explicit-exit-notify参数的OpenVPN配置文件例子:
client
dev tun
proto udp
remote vpn.example.com 1194
resolv-retry infinite
nobind
persist-key
persist-tun
ca ca.crt
cert client.crt
key client.key
remote-cert-tls server
explicit-exit-notify yes
在上面的例子中,我们使用了explicit-exit-notify参数,并将它设置为yes。这将使客户端在退出时发送一个显式的退出通知给服务器。
注意:如果使用了显式退出通知,OpenVPN客户端会在退出时发送一个SIGTERM信号给OpenVPN进程。如果您在脚本中使用了SIGTERM信号来执行一些操作,请注意避免与OpenVPN客户端的SIGTERM信号冲突
原文地址: https://www.cveoy.top/t/topic/hhNt 著作权归作者所有。请勿转载和采集!